What does peridotite look like?

What does peridotite look like?

Classic peridotite is bright green with some specks of black, although most hand samples tend to be darker green. Peridotitic outcrops typically range from earthy bright yellow to dark green in color; this is because olivine is easily weathered to iddingsite.

What are the properties of peridotite?

Peridotite is a very dense, coarse-grained, olivine-rich, ultra- mafic intrusive rock. It is noted for its low silica content, and contains very little or no feldspar ( orthoclase, plagioclase). It is a common component of oceanic lithosphere, and is derived from the upper mantle.

What type of stone is peridotite?

peridotite, a coarse-grained, dark-coloured, heavy, intrusive igneous rock that contains at least 10 percent olivine, other iron- and magnesia-rich minerals (generally pyroxenes), and not more than 10 percent feldspar.

Does peridotite have quartz?

Peridotite is a generic name used for coarse-grained, dark-colored, ultramafic igneous rocks. Their silica content is low compared to other igneous rocks, and they contain very little quartz and feldspar.

What is peridotite quizlet?

peridotite. A coarse-grained ultramafic intrusive igneous rock composed of olivine with small amounts of pyroxene and amphibole. The dominant rock in Earth’s mantle and the source rock of basaltic melts.

What is the importance of peridotite?

Peridotites are economically important rocks because they often contain chromite – the only ore of chromium; they can be source rocks for diamonds; and, they have the potential to be used as a material for sequestering carbon dioxide. Much of Earth’s mantle is believed to be composed of peridotite.

Why is basalt important?

Basalt is used for a wide variety of purposes. It is most commonly crushed for use as an aggregate in construction projects. Crushed basalt is used for road base, concrete aggregate, asphalt pavement aggregate, railroad ballast, filter stone in drain fields, and may other purposes.

Where do you find basalt?

It is found all over Earth, but especially under the oceans and in other areas where Earth’s crust is thin. It formed in the Isle Royale-Keweenaw region because of the Midcontinent Rift. Most of Earth’s surface is basalt lava, but basalt makes up only a small fraction of continents.

What kind of rock is the peridotite rock made of?

Peridotite is a dark-colored igneous rock consisting mostly of olivine and pyroxene. It is an important rock type because the Earth’s mantle is predominantly composed of it.

Where can you find peridotite in the mantle?

Ophiolites and pipes are two structures that have brought mantle peridotite to the surface. Peridotite is also found in the igneous rocks of sills and dikes. Ophiolites: An ophiolite is a large slab of oceanic crust, including part of the mantle, that has been overthrust onto continental crust at a convergent plate boundary.

How big is a thin section of Horoman peridotite?

This image shows a full thin section of Horoman peridotite. The 29-mm long dimension is actually shorter than a typical thin section, which is usually between 38 mm and 42 mm. The coarse texture of the peridotite is evident in this image. For example, the large olivine grain just left of center is about 10 mm in length.

What are the colors of the peridotite grains?

Peridotite (harzburgite), Onion Camp complex, Klamath Mountains, Grains with vivid interference colors are olivine; yellowish gray grains at bootom center and top left are orthopyroxene; dark gray areas with light gray and white polygons are serpentine. XPL Imaged area 1.3 mm by 2 mm. Photo by Dan Snyder.
